Khoros is seeking a Program Coordinator to join the Customer Retention team. We need someone who is able to manage multiple projects for at-risk accounts; someone who excels at following up and ensuring that commitments are met. You’ll need to have a willingness to learn to lead conversations with all levels of both customer and internal, high communication know how, and learn the Khoros product line.

Responsibilities

  • Work cross functionality to coordinate plays to improve customer health
  • Track progress on projects
  • Identify trending pain points and escalate to corresponding departments
  • Execute on internal follow up around our Retention Program, a system where our at-risk customers are reviewed and managed
  • Assist in buildout and running of User Recognition program
  • Work with external customers, as needed, to schedule discussions and ensure effective conversations
  • Ensure that project plans and notes are kept effectively
  • Have discussions with customers on their concerns 
  • Be passionate around making our customer’s experience better, even if that means banging down some doors.
  • Understand and learn the ins-and-outs of the Khoros business, product lines and structure in order to truly be effective in a cross-functional role
